The Enchanted Library of What's Imagined: The Quest for the Lost Story
Once upon a time, in a quaint village nestled between rolling hills and whispering forests, there stood an ancient library known as The Enchanted Library of What's Imagined. This was no ordinary library; its shelves were not filled with books but with stories, each one a tapestry woven from the dreams and thoughts of those who visited it. The air was thick with the scent of parchment and the hum of a thousand voices, each story alive with its own magic.
In this library, the most wondrous tales were said to be those that had been lost, forgotten, or never written. These were the stories that held the power to shape reality, to alter the course of lives, and to bring about change. The librarian, an elderly woman with eyes as wise as the stars, whispered of one such story that had vanished without a trace.
The tale of the lost story had been passed down through generations, a legend whispered among the children of the village. It was said that the story had the power to make the impossible possible, and the one who found it would be granted a single wish.
One sunny afternoon, a young girl named Elara stumbled upon the library while chasing a butterfly. Her eyes were wide with wonder as she wandered through the labyrinth of shelves, her fingers brushing against the spines of books that seemed to pulse with life. She had always been an avid reader, but today, something felt different. The air was charged with an energy she had never felt before, and she knew it was meant for her.
Elara found herself drawn to a single book, its cover intricately carved with symbols she couldn't quite decipher. She opened it, and the words seemed to leap off the page, each one a whisper of a forgotten tale. She read of a world where dreams and reality intertwined, where the lines between the two were blurred, and where the power of imagination was as real as the stone walls of the library.
The librarian, noticing Elara's fascination, approached her with a gentle smile. "You are meant to be here, young one," she said. "The lost story you seek is not just a tale; it is a quest, a journey that will test your courage, your heart, and your mind."
Elara nodded, her eyes sparkling with determination. "I will find it," she declared.
The librarian handed her a small, leather-bound journal. "This will be your guide. Within its pages, you will find clues, riddles, and warnings. But remember, the path to the lost story is fraught with danger, and the answers you seek are hidden in plain sight."
With the journal in hand, Elara set off on her quest. She visited the Whispering Woods, where the trees seemed to murmur secrets of old; she wandered through the Glimmering Lake, where the water shimmered with the reflection of a thousand suns; and she climbed the Spire of Shadows, where the wind sang tales of the past.
Each step of her journey brought her closer to the truth, but it was not until she reached the Heart of Imagination that she truly understood the magnitude of her quest. The Heart was a place where dreams were born and reality was redefined. It was here that Elara faced her greatest challenge, a test of her resolve and her courage.
The Heart was guarded by the Keeper of Dreams, a figure cloaked in shadows and adorned with the symbols of the lost story. "You seek the lost story, but you must first prove your worth," the Keeper said, his voice like the rustle of leaves in the wind.
Elara took a deep breath and began to speak, her voice clear and strong. She recounted her journey, the challenges she had faced, and the lessons she had learned. She spoke of the power of imagination, the importance of courage, and the strength of the human spirit.
The Keeper listened, his eyes narrowing with thought. "You have shown that you are worthy," he finally said. "The lost story is yours to find."
With the Keeper's blessing, Elara continued her quest. She followed the clues in her journal, each one leading her to a new place, a new challenge, and a new understanding of the magic that lay within her.
Finally, after days of searching, Elara arrived at the final destination: the library's highest shelf, where the book of the lost story lay hidden. She opened it, and the room seemed to grow brighter, the air to fill with a sense of wonder and excitement.
As she read the final words of the story, she felt a surge of energy course through her. The story was not just a tale; it was a reality, a world that had been waiting for her to bring it to life.
Elara closed the book, and the room returned to its former state, but she knew that the story was now part of her. She had found the lost story, and with it, she had found her own voice, her own power.
Back in the village, Elara shared her story with the librarian and the children of the village. She showed them the power of imagination, the importance of courage, and the magic that lay within each of them.
And so, The Enchanted Library of What's Imagined continued to be a place of wonder and magic, where the lost stories were found, and the dreams of every imagination were made real.
